Kwara Gov mourns as body of 'missing' Yusuf Mubarak found
Mubarak, a new media personality who hails from Ilorin, went missing on Wednesday night but his remains were eventually found around Unity area of the state capital. He was buried on Saturday evening in Ilorin amid tears by friends, associates and acquaintances.
The Governor sends his heartfelt condolences to the family of Mubaarak, his friends, and all the youth constituencies in the state.
The Governor, himself a father, strongly condemns the cowardly violence meted to the lad and demands immediate and thorough investigation into the death of the promising chap to arrest and bring his assailants to justice.
“No resources should be spared to get justice for Mubaarak and his family. We charge the security agencies to cast their nets as widely as possible to answer all pending questions around his painful death,” according to a Government House statement on Saturday night.
The Governor prays Allah to grant Mubaarak Al-Jannah Firdaus and comfort his family and everyone who mourns the promising lad.
